Recently, BEFANBY successfully commissioned and deployed a custom-engineered 60-ton low-voltage rail-powered ladle transfer cart for a client in the large-scale material transport sector. This vehicle provides an efficient solution for the high-temperature, heavy-load transfer of steel ladles within the client's production facility.

 

As shown in on-site photos, the heavy-duty rail cart features a high-strength steel plate structure clearly marked with a 60-ton rated load capacity. It is equipped with reinforced triangular support brackets on both sides, specifically designed to cradle and transport high-temperature steel ladles. Black anti-collision strips are installed on the cart body to serve both as safety warnings and equipment protection, while raised side guardrails securely hold the ladle vessel in place, eliminating the risk of load shifting or tipping during transport.

The cart operates using a low-voltage rail power supply system; specialized power rails installed on the factory floor deliver safe, low-voltage electricity continuously. This setup removes range limitations, enabling 24-hour uninterrupted operation that aligns perfectly with the continuous pace of steelmaking, while eliminating the need for frequent charging or cable handling.

 

Regarding load capacity, the vehicle is rated for 60 tons and constructed from thickened, wear-resistant welded steel plates, significantly enhancing its resistance to impact and deformation caused by high temperatures.

 

Additionally, the cart supports customizable control schemes, offering a dual-mode system that combines a wired handheld controller with a wireless remote. Operators can manage forward and backward movement, speed adjustment, and start/stop functions from a distance, keeping them away from the high-temperature ladle zone to minimize burn risks—making it ideal for the harsh, high-temperature, and dusty environments typical of metallurgical workshops.
